Jonathan Gold
5e5bbf4b39 travis: Allow travis builds to access target branches
Because travis builds only fetch a single branch (master) by default,
test-commit-message.sh only had access to commits in the master branch.
In order to fetch the correct branch for our build, we need to run
'git config remote.origin.fetch..' with the target branch's information
before executing git fetch on the repo in before_install.

Now git will always fetch the appropriate branch.

James Shubin
0edba74091 etcd: Bump to version 3.2.6 and update all the grpc deps
Note: When go-grpc-prometheus was in the main $gopath (even at this
version) and everyone else was where they always were in vendor/ this
didn't build! It gave errors like:

	have SendHeader("github.com/purpleidea/mgmt/vendor/google.golang.org/grpc/metadata".MD) error
	want SendHeader("google.golang.org/grpc/metadata".MD) error

and I got frustrated. Putting it "next" to the other vendored deps seems
to have fixed this. Where are the golang docs that explain this
phenomenon?

This also requires golang 1.8+ as that is a requirement for etcd. It's
probably a reasonable thing for us too.

Note the older versions of etcd had some bugs with the concurrency
package and other things, so this is a necessary bump.

James Shubin
358604def2 Enable shell tests
We need to use sudo: required, and dist: trusty to avoid old versions of
bash in travis which don't support the -n argument to the `wait` shell
built-in.

We had to disable the -e checks in etcd.sh since the killall || killall
parts were causing those to trigger in travis.
